A change of state from solid to liquid, or liquid to gas, or directly solid to gas., all indicate an increase in entropy. Also an increase in moles from reactants to products. The Classic example being the thermal decomposition of calcium carbonate CaCO3(s) ==Heat==> CaO(s) + CO2(g) You have a gas liberated from a solid, so an increase in entropy. You also have one mole reactant increasing to two moles of product, so again an increase in entropy.
